Eye Check-Up Camp Organized at Paradip International Cargo Terminal in Collaboration with Dr. Agarwal’s Eye Hospital

PICT's Free Eye Check-Up Camp at Paradip

Paradip, December 20, 2024 — A comprehensive eye check-up camp was organized at the Paradip International Cargo Terminal (PICT) today in collaboration with the renowned Dr. Agarwal’s Eye Hospital. The initiative aimed to promote eye health and create awareness among the terminal’s workforce and the local community.

The camp was inaugurated by the Terminal Head, Mr. Rajesh Nayak, who emphasized the importance of regular eye check-ups for maintaining overall health and ensuring workplace safety. Speaking at the event, Mr. Nayak said, “At PICT, we are committed to the well-being of our employees and the community we serve. This camp is a step towards fostering a healthier work environment and addressing potential vision-related issues early on.”

The eye check-up camp saw active participation from terminal staff, dock workers, and members of the surrounding community. A team of expert ophthalmologists and support staff from Dr. Agarwal’s Eye Hospital conducted detailed eye examinations, which included vision tests, screenings for cataracts, glaucoma, and other common eye conditions. Free consultation and advice were also provided to all attendees.

Mr. Sanjay Mishra, a worker at the terminal who attended the camp, expressed his gratitude, saying, “This is a wonderful initiative. Many of us often neglect eye care due to our busy schedules. Such camps help us stay informed about our eye health and take necessary precautions.”

In addition to eye check-ups, the camp also distributed informational pamphlets on maintaining good eye health, tips for workplace eye safety, and the importance of protective eyewear.

Dr. Agarwal’s Eye Hospital, a pioneer in eye care, has been a trusted name in the field for decades. Their collaboration with PICT for this camp underscores their commitment to extending quality healthcare services to communities beyond their hospital premises.

The event concluded on a positive note, with over 200 individuals benefitting from the free eye screenings and consultations. PICT plans to organize similar health camps in the future to address other aspects of employee and community health.
